After a lot of highs and lows, 'Star Trek: Picard' Season 1 drew to a close on March 26, with much fanfare. After a worrying cliffhanger in the previous episode, Picard manages to bring Soji back from the brink of bloodlust.

There is an epic showdown with the Romulans, a much-needed conversation between Picard and Data (Brent Spiner) in a simulation, and the promise of a new beginning.

We almost lose Picard, due to his brain abnormality — but hey, this is 'Picard' and 'Star Trek' and there's nothing that technology and science can't fix. And so, Picard is a synth now. To be fair, we saw that coming. 

Soji (Isa Briones), who traveled to hell and back just to see her home planet, decides to abandon the idea and go with Picard and the La Sirena crew. She says that she is a wanderer.

Soji has had quite a painful arc in this season, as she had to learn in the most unpleasant way possible that she was a synth and that her memories of childhood had been falsely implanted.

Apart from that, she suffered a heartbreak when she realized that her Romulan boyfriend Narek (Harry Treadaway) had been manipulating her and was about to kill her. Narek does have a change of heart by the end of the season, but Soji is in no mood to bury the hatchet. 

Nevertheless, the finale ends with the whole La Sirena crew waiting for Picard to say "Engage". There are a whole lot of people present on that ship, including Raffi Musiker (Michelle Hurd), Seven Of Nine (Jeri Ryan), Rios, Dr Agnes Jurati (Allison Pills) and Elnor. 

Now that Season 2 is on the cards, here are some questions we have in mind.

Where is Narek? Will the Zhat Vhash stop hunting synths?

Narek did a 180 degree and decided to help out the La Sirena crew.... and then vanished from sight. Obviously, this isn't the last we have seen of him, as he and Soji still have some issues to sort out. However, the more pressing question is, what's happening with the Zhat Vhash? Synth life is not banned anymore, true. But Zhat Vhash has shown it is capable of murder and more. Will they return in the next season?

Will we get to know more about Raffi?

We know tantalizing clues about Raffi Musiker's life. For one, her career ended when Picard left Starfleet. And, she has a son, who wants nothing to do with her. Raffi Musiker is a tough character and hasn't been given adequate screen time. So let's hope, that in Season 2, we learn more about her. Fans also seem to think that there is something going on between her and Seven Of Nine. That should make an interesting watch.

How will life change for Picard as a synthetic being?

Picard is now a synth, just like his late best friend Data (Brent Spiner). So will life be any different for the gracious and venerated Captain? Of course, it will be. You can expect a lot of drama in this regard, for the next season.
